Teaching objectives
At the end of the training, the participant will be able to:
Define precisely what digital accessibility is, and distinguish it from related fields such as ergonomics, quality, etc.
Digital accessibility standards: international rules (WCAG) and the RGAA reference framework
Integrate accessibility rules into development practices
Designing a code that complies with accessibility rulesandourchariot
Debugging non-accessible code
Dialogue with accessibility consultants in the event of an audit

Intended audience
Web developers, integrators.

Prerequisites
Have completed the "Digital Accessibility Awareness" training course, and have advanced knowledge of website development.

Course schedule

1
Accessibility overview

  • Users concerned by web accessibility.
  • Accessibility standards (WCAG or RGAA).
  • Legal accessibility requirements.
  • Structuring a web page.
Hands-on work
Adapting a web page to meet accessibility requirements.

2
Mandatory elements, links and navigation

  • Must-know items.
  • The link constraint.
  • Ensure compliant navigation.
Hands-on work
Creating links and setting up compliant navigation.

3
Information and consultation issues

  • Information presentation issues.
  • Consultation: understanding the ins and outs.
Hands-on work
Analysis of the consultation.

4
Images, tables and links

  • The use of images.
  • The textual alternative.
  • Text adaptation of infographics.
  • CSS background management.
  • Setting up captions.
  • SVG and visual CAPTCHA.
  • Setting up the colors.
  • Create accessible tables.
Hands-on work
Integration of images and tables.

5
Multimedia and scripts

  • Compliant multimedia content.
  • Set up compliant scripts.
Hands-on work
Creation of scripts adapted to accessibility.

6
Frames and forms

  • Create accessible forms.
  • The development of compliant frames.
Hands-on work
Design accessible forms.
